Looking for a challenging but rewarding career in human services? The Moore Center provides services in a clinical home environment to individuals who have various intellectual disabilities and may also have additional mental health challenges. 

We’re also pioneering a new ground-breaking program in New Hampshire that provides emergency services for individuals with intellectual disabilities who face crisis situations.

Our new Emergency Temporary Placement program (ETP) offers temporary placement in a clinical home environment, with care managed by our team of professionals. It’s a residential program where as a Clinical Life Skills Coach (Direct Support Professional) you’ll provide direct care to ensure stabilization and temporary respite for individuals in crisis situations. You’ll also assist in creating and conducting sensory activities as appropriate for the client base that incorporate fun and/or mindfulness.

It’s a fast-paced and rewarding environment where you’ll be in a key position to help individuals transition through a critical time in their lives. Clients who are eligible for participation in this program have various intellectual disabilities and may also have additional mental health challenges.
